Relieve Gout Pain Immediately: Fast and Preventative Strategies

Experiencing a sudden, severe gout flare? Avoid suffering! The initial response is critical. To begin with, elevate the swollen joint and apply ice treatments for 20 minutes at a time, several times daily. Over-the-counter remedies like NSAIDs can help reduce inflammation, but always consult your doctor before use. Drinking plenty of water is vital to flush out excess uric acid. Avoiding future attacks involves dietary adjustments; limit high-purine foods such as red meat, organ meats, and sugary drinks. Maintaining a healthy weight, staying hydrated and speaking with your physician about possible medication can also help control uric acid levels and significantly decrease the frequency of gout flares. Consider these steps for both immediate relief and lasting protection.

  • Elevate the painful joint
  • Apply cooling treatments
  • Drink liquids
  • Limit high-purine foods
  • Speak to your doctor

The End of Gout: Lifestyle Changes That Work

Managing this gout can be that achievable goal with basic lifestyle changes. Emphasizing dietary habits is essential; limiting those with purines foods like red meat, organ meats, and certain seafood can significantly lower uric acid levels. In addition to, maintaining a good weight through regular physical activity – be it walking, swimming, or any preferred form of exercise – is crucial. Furthermore, staying adequately hydrated by drinking plenty of water helps eliminate excess uric acid from your system. Finally, limiting alcohol consumption, particularly beer and sugary drinks, provides a substantial boost in this affliction management.
